Why You’re Losing Money Without Realizing It
Before diving into solutions, understand the culprits behind everyday financial leaks:
- Frequent Small Purchases: Daily coffee, snacks, and impulse buys may seem trivial, but they total hundreds each month.
- Auto-Deductions Without Review: Automatic subscriptions and recurring charges often go unnoticed, draining funds unchecked.
- Lack of Negotiated Savings: Utilities, internet, insurance, and even cable bills rarely get renegotiated despite better deals available.
- Emotional Spending: Buying on impulse driven by stress, boredom, or trends bypasses budget discipline.
- Ignoring Low-Interest Savings: Leaving money in checking accounts earns little or nothing while inflation erodes purchasing power.

The Transformative Save Strategy: The “Trigger + Track” Method
Step 1: Automate the Invisible Savings Trigger
Set up automatic transfers from your checking to savings or investments as soon as you receive paychecks. Even saving 5–10% of every paycheck removes the temptation to spend first, save later. Use apps to schedule round-up features—rounding up purchases to the nearest dollar and transferring the difference instantly.
Step 2: Daily Expense Awareness Check-In
Spend two minutes each evening reviewing your day’s spending. Use a quick budgeting app or a simple notebook. Ask: Did this purchase align with my financial goals? Small wins like skipping coffee or canceling unused subscriptions can save $20–$50 daily—much more than you think.
Step 3: Review and Renegotiate Monthly
Once a month, submit requests to lower recurring costs. Call your gym, internet provider, bank, and insurance agent. Highlight competing offers—many companies will waive fees or adjust rates to retain you. This small effort can save $50–$200 per month.

Step 4: Adopt the 24-Hour Hold on Non-Essential Buys
Implement a cooling-off period for purchases over $25. This pause disrupts impulsive decisions and strengthens budget self-control.
How This Strategy Transforms Your Budget
By combining automatic savings with daily mindfulness, you automatically redirect hundreds—sometimes thousands—of dollars into savings without sacrificing quality of life. The key benefits include:
- Consistent Growth: Even small daily savings compound dramatically over months and years.
- Financial Confidence: Regaining control of your money reduces stress and empowers smarter decisions.
- No Lifestyle Sacrifice: The trigger system saves automation-friendly amounts before spending, keeping your routines intact.
- Inflation Protection: Starting early and saving regularly preserves future purchasing power.
